Footage shows the police search this afternoon for the missing girlfriend of the British teenager murdered in Thailand.

Suraphltchaya Khamsa, 16, was the last person with Woramet Ben Taota, 16, before he was found dead in Lampang province on Sunday morning May 7.

The alleged killer Chaiwat Boongarin, 44, was taken on a crime reconstruction this afternoon where Ben's furious father Steven Graham and mother Ooy Taota branded him an 'evil coward' and screamed 'rot in hell'.

However, mystery still surrounds the disappearance of pretty schoolgirl Suraphltchaya, who had the nickname 'Ping Pong', who was seen on CCTV riding a motorcycle with Ben in the hours before he was allegedly bludgeoned to death in secluded woodland.

Sex crimes convict Chaiwat - who was recently released from prison - has refused to give any details of what has happened to the girlfriend, despite repeated interrogations by policemen.

Cops said that more than 30 officers and sniffer dogs from Lampang Provincial Police and the Border Patrol Police had started scouring the woodland on foot and used drones for aerial views.

Police Major General Mongkol Sampawapol, commander of Lampang Provincial Police, said: 'The young girl who was with the victim has not been found.

'The search operation has now been expanded to include the forests and roads within three miles of the nearby villages. We have deployed a drone to capture aerial images to survey the roads and the densely overgrown grove forest from above.

'Officers have been searching since 10am this morning. The phone messages have also been checked and the murderer is being interrogated.'

Video of Chaiwat being taken back to where Ben's body was found shows him telling police which direction he arrived from and how he left. He is seen showing them how he left on a black Honda motorcycle which he later hid with a relative.
